Setting Up Payroll for Your Small Business

Paying your team on time and accurately is essential for any small business. Implementing a smooth payroll procedure can seem daunting, but it's crucial for keeping your employees happy and compliant with labor laws. First understanding the different types of payroll, whether you'll be managing it in-house or utilizing a third-party provider.

Once you've determined your strategy, it's important to obtain all the necessary data from your employees, including their tax filings and banking information.

Don't forget about federal and state requirements regarding payroll taxes. Ensuring up to date on these standards is vital to avoid penalties and challenges.

Finally, establish a clear payroll schedule that works for your business and communicate it effectively to your employees.

Maximize Efficiency: Outsourcing Your Payroll

Running a small business is challenging enough without the added headache of managing payroll. Challenges can arise from calculating wages, deductions, taxes, and ensuring compliance with ever-changing regulations. This is where outsourcing payroll becomes an invaluable tool. By delegating your payroll tasks to a specialized provider, you can unlock valuable time and assets to focus on what truly matters: growing your business.

  • Error-Free Payroll: Outsourcing delivers that payroll is processed accurately and promptly, reducing the risk of costly errors.
  • Lower Expenses: Outsourcing can often be more cost-effective than managing payroll in-house, as it eliminates the need for dedicated staff, software, and ongoing training.
  • Effortless Regulatory Adherence: Payroll providers stay up-to-date on all relevant laws, ensuring your business remains in line with regulations.
